RX 100 Tyre Pressure

The required tyre pressure for RX 100 front tyre is 22 psi, and for rear tyre is 32 psi. Yamaha RX 100 Bike comes in 1 variant(s) and below you can find the correct tyre pressure that needs to be filled in all 2 tyres. The air pressure for RX 100 Tyres varies for Loaded and Unloaded vehicle. Popular tyre manufacturers that produces tyres for Yamaha RX 100 are MRF, CEAT and Apollo

Recommended tyre pressure for Yamaha RX 100

Without Load

  • Front

    22 PSI

  • Rear

    28 PSI

With Load

  • Front

    22 PSI

  • Rear

    32 PSI
